--- Comment #18 from Tejun Heo 2009-11-17 17:15:15 UTC ---
Yeah, I looked at them and diff'd them. I don't know how you did the testing
but it looks like the device node for bare hadd was hanging around till you did
preplug lshal and later went away before you did post lshals (ATA drive
unplugging usually takes from 15 to 20 secs). If the kernel isn't noticing it,
there simply is no way hal would know anything about it.
Does booting with "libata.force=1.5Gbps" make any difference? Can you please
boot with the parameter, hotplug the eSATA device and then attach full output
of dmesg?
